Output 2a86163e0221468ca24f3b31f4040a4c5bff962bbfb80fb7d5fdc0c670fd44f3:9

value
1779200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e95fa58504e638f6d5bfa65920f2e2fe4c8752 OP_EQUAL
address
3CXmEGDH97nwr677x69xVEvhaQCHDWyLfp
transaction
2a86163e0221468ca24f3b31f4040a4c5bff962bbfb80fb7d5fdc0c670fd44f3
confirmations
309105
spent
true